2,000km, eight countries, 29 days - the fastest runner to cross the Alps

Ultra-runner Sophie Woods has set a new record by running 2,000 kilometres across eight countries in 29 days.

She achieved the feat by completing the Via Alpina, which is recognised as one of the world's toughest endurance challenges.
